The Wind Waker HD’s Hero Mode Will Up The Difficulty

The Wii U remake of one of the best games ever made will feature Hero Mode making enemies deal double the damage and meaning that you won’t be able to find hearts in the environment; you’ll instead need to use potions or fairies to recover your health.

It appears to be extremely similar to the mode of the same name found in Skyward Sword, rather than being akin to Ocarina of Time’s Master Quest, which completely changed the puzzles and progression in temples and dungeons, as well as flipping the perspective in the 3DS version, offering a fresh experience of the same game.

Still, it’s something entirely new for the fans, alongside all of the other improvements, which we detailed in our preview of the game. I really can’t wait for the game; it releases in Europe on the fourth of October.
